Analysis

The most recent figure for share of urban and rural population using safely managed sanitation services in Netherlands is 97.5%, measured in 2024. That is the highest value across all 25 years on record.

That represents a change of up 0.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, share of urban and rural population using safely managed sanitation services in Netherlands peaked at 97.5% in 2020 and was at its lowest, 97.4%, in 2003.

Netherlands ranks 4th of 100 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

About this data

Indicator
Share of urban and rural population using safely managed sanitation services
Unit
%
Source
WHO/UNICEF Joint Monitoring Programme for Water Supply, Sanitation and Hygiene (2025) – processed by Our World in Data
Licence
CC BY 4.0 (Our World in Data)
Coverage
100 places, 2,464 data points, 2000–2024
Last refreshed

Proportion of people using improved sanitation facilities that are not shared with other households and where excreta are safely disposed in situ or transported and treated off-site.
